Code · California · Harbors and Navigation Code

§ 6943

From the time of the organization of any district until the next succeeding July 1st, or in the event that a district is formed between February 1st and July 1st of any year then until one year from the next succeeding July 1st after the formation thereof, the district may incur indebtedness for the purpose of operating the port and the district and in the first tax levy, the rate shall be in an amount sufficient to operate the port and the district for the first full fiscal year as well as to pay the obligations incurred as herein provided for.
